Understanding ADHD Assessment

Before diving into the numerous choices available for ADHD assessments, it is essential to comprehend what an ADHD assessment entails. It generally consists of several parts, including:

  • Clinical Interview: A discussion about your history, signs, and operating in numerous settings (e.g., home, school, work).

  • Standardized Questionnaires: Used to examine ADHD signs and their influence on every day life.

  • Behavioral Observations: Sometimes part of the assessment, observations can assist determine behaviors linked to ADHD.

  • Cognitive Testing: In some cases, tests may be utilized to evaluate attention and executive function.

Table: Average Costs of ADHD Assessments in the UK

Type of AssessmentAverage CostDurationProvider Type
NHS Adult ADHD AssessmentFreeVariesNHS Clinics
NHS Child ADHD AssessmentFreeVariesNHS Clinics
Private ADHD Assessment₤ 300 - ₤ 8001-3 hoursPrivate Psychiatrists/Clinics
Online ADHD Assessment₤ 150 - ₤ 2501-2 hoursOnline Platforms
School-based ADHD ScreeningDiffersDiffersSchools/Counselors

Keep in mind:

The expenses noted are approximate averages and might differ depending on area and the credentials of the service provider.

Choices for Affordable ADHD Assessments

1. NHS Services

The National Health Service (NHS) offers ADHD assessments at no cost to individuals, depending upon eligibility. To access these services, people typically require a recommendation from their General Practitioner (GP). The waiting times for assessment can be lengthy, so it is necessary to ask at your local NHS clinic to get an updated timeline.

Benefits:

  • No cost
  • Comprehensive assessments conducted by qualified professionals

Downsides:

  • Potentially long waiting times

2. Private Clinics

Private centers use a quicker path to assessment due to fewer bureaucratic hurdles. While private assessments tend to range from ₤ 300 to ₤ 800, lots of people discover the minimized waiting time worth the cost. Some centers even provide payment strategies to spread out the cost.

Advantages:

  • Reduced waiting time
  • Versatile consultation scheduling

Drawbacks:

  • Higher out-of-pocket costs

3. Online Assessments

With the increase of telemedicine, several online platforms use ADHD assessments that are both effective and affordable, normally ranging from ₤ 150 to ₤ 250. This alternative is particularly hassle-free for people with hectic schedules or those living in remote areas.

Advantages:

  • Convenience of assessment from home
  • Usually lower expenses than in-person assessments

Downsides:

  • Lack of physical exam and personal interaction
  • May not be as comprehensive as face-to-face assessments

4. School-Based Assessments

For kids and teenagers, many schools have screening programs to identify possible ADHD or other discovering disorders. While the screenings might not offer an extensive diagnosis, they can be an initial step and frequently come at no cost.

Benefits:

  • No cost for families
  • Early identification of possible problems

Drawbacks:

  • Limited scope; might require additional assessment for an official medical diagnosis

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How do I understand if I require an ADHD assessment?

If you or your child shows signs such as trouble focusing, impulsivity, or hyperactivity, it may be worth discussing with a healthcare professional. They can help determine if an assessment is required.

2. Are ADHD assessments covered by health insurance in the UK?

Most assessments through the NHS are free. Private assessments might or may not be covered based on individual medical insurance strategies, so examining with your provider is advisable.

3. Can adults be diagnosed with ADHD?

Yes, ADHD can be diagnosed in adults. Many people may have gone undiagnosed as children, and symptoms can persist into adulthood.

4. What should I expect during the assessment process?

Anticipate a comprehensive medical interview, completion of questionnaires, and potentially cognitive testing. The process might take several hours and follow-up might be needed for a last diagnosis.

5. For how long does it require to get outcomes from an ADHD assessment?

Results will depend on the service provider and the type of assessment. NHS assessments might take longer due to the variety of cases, while private assessments typically offer quicker feedback.
